Which UK Regions Have the Most Active Tradesmen?

According to recent data analysis, tradesmen are distributed across the UK with notable concentrations in specific regions:

RegionNumber of TradesmenPercentage of Total
Greater London36,08522.6%
South East25,86616.2%
North West15,7709.9%
South West16,98010.6%
West Midlands12,3307.7%

What is a UK tradesmen database?

A UK tradesmen database is a digital directory that lists verified trades professionals across the United Kingdom, including electricians, plumbers, and builders. These platforms typically include contact information, qualifications, reviews, and service areas.

How can I check if a tradesman is qualified in the UK?

You can verify a tradesman’s qualifications through official government-recognised bodies like the Gas Safe Register or NICEIC. Many UK tradesmen databases also include certification badges and vetting processes to ensure professional standards.

Which UK government site can verify a tradesman’s gas safety registration?

You can check a tradesman’s gas safety registration through the official Gas Safe Register, which is the only legal register for gas engineers in the UK.

Are there industry-specific databases for trades in the UK?

Yes, in addition to general directories, there are trade-specific databases like Checkatrade for general trades and Rated People for home renovation professionals. Some, such as TrustMark, are endorsed by the UK government.

Where can I report a complaint about a tradesman found through a database?

Most platforms have complaint resolution procedures, but you can also contact your local Trading Standards office via the UK government’s citizens advice site.
